Canadian spy agency says it hacked drug traffickers, extremists, and a ransomware gang last year

The Canadian Security Intelligence Service (CSIS) has disclosed in its annual report that it conducted hacking operations against drug traffickers, extremists, and a ransomware gang last year. This revelation highlights the agency's proactive approach to addressing significant national security threats facing Canada and its allies.

Background

CSIS is Canada's primary domestic intelligence and security agency, responsible for protecting the country from threats such as espionage, sabotage, and terrorism. The disclosure of offensive cyber capabilities marks a significant shift in how intelligence agencies are perceived and operates within democratic frameworks.
